|
| template<typename T > |
| void | FDynamicMesh3Serialization_Local::SerializeVector (FArchive &Ar, TDynamicVector< T > &Vector, const FDynamicMesh3SerializationOptions &Options) |
| |
| template<typename T > |
| void | FDynamicMesh3Serialization_Local::SerializeOptionalVector (FArchive &Ar, TOptional< TDynamicVector< T > > &OptionalVector, const FDynamicMesh3SerializationOptions &Options) |
| |
| void | FDynamicMesh3Serialization_Local::SerializeUniqueVertexData (FArchive &Ar, TDynamicVector< FVector3d > &Vertices, TOptional< TDynamicVector< FVector3f > > &VertexNormals, TOptional< TDynamicVector< FVector3f > > &VertexColors, TOptional< TDynamicVector< FVector2f > > &VertexUVs, const FDynamicMesh3SerializationOptions &Options) |
| |
| void | FDynamicMesh3Serialization_Local::SerializeUniqueTriangleData (FArchive &Ar, TDynamicVector< FIndex3i > &Triangles, TOptional< TDynamicVector< int32 > > &TriangleGroups, int &GroupIDCounter, const FDynamicMesh3SerializationOptions &Options) |
| |
| void | FDynamicMesh3Serialization_Local::SerializeRefCounts (FArchive &Ar, FRefCountVector &RefCounts, const FDynamicMesh3SerializationOptions &Options) |
| |
| void | FDynamicMesh3Serialization_Local::ResetDenseTriangleRefCounts (size_t Num, FRefCountVector &TriangleRefCounts) |
| |
| void | FDynamicMesh3Serialization_Local::RecomputeVertexRefCounts (size_t NumVertices, const TDynamicVector< FIndex3i > &Triangles, const FRefCountVector &TriangleRefCounts, FRefCountVector &VertexRefCounts) |
| |
| void | FDynamicMesh3Serialization_Local::SerializeSmallListSet (FArchive &Ar, FSmallListSet &SmallListSet, const FDynamicMesh3SerializationOptions &Options) |
| |
| template<typename FindEdgeFunc , typename AddEdgeInternalFunc > |
| void | FDynamicMesh3Serialization_Local::RecomputeEdgeData (const TDynamicVector< FVector3d > &Vertices, const TDynamicVector< FIndex3i > &Triangles, const FRefCountVector &TriangleRefCounts, TDynamicVector< FDynamicMesh3::FEdge > &Edges, FRefCountVector &EdgeRefCounts, TDynamicVector< FIndex3i > &TriangleEdges, FSmallListSet &VertexEdgeLists, FindEdgeFunc &&FindEdge, AddEdgeInternalFunc &&AddEdgeInternal) |
| |
| void | FDynamicMesh3Serialization_Local::SerializeAttributeSet (FArchive &Ar, FDynamicMesh3 *Mesh, const FCompactMaps *CompactMaps, const FDynamicMesh3SerializationOptions &Options) |
| |
| template<typename T > |
| TOptional< TDynamicVector< T > > | FDynamicMesh3Serialization_Local::CreateOptionalVector (const TOptional< TDynamicVector< T > > &ExistingOptionalVector, size_t Num) |
| |
| template<> |
| void | FDynamicMesh3::SerializeInternal< CompactAndCompress+FDynamicMesh3SerializationOptions::Default > (FArchive &, void *) |
| |
| template<> |
| void | FDynamicMesh3::SerializeInternal< CompactAndCompress+FDynamicMesh3SerializationOptions::CompactData > (FArchive &, void *) |
| |
| template<> |
| void | FDynamicMesh3::SerializeInternal< CompactAndCompress+FDynamicMesh3SerializationOptions::Default > (FArchive &Ar, void *OptionsPtr) |
| |
| template<> |
| void | FDynamicMesh3::SerializeInternal< CompactAndCompress+FDynamicMesh3SerializationOptions::CompactData > (FArchive &Ar, void *OptionsPtr) |
| |